+/**
+ * Abstract class that implements methods to parse a resource file
+ */
+public class AbstractResourceFileParser implements IResourceTypesAttributes
+{
+ /**
+ * The root nodes of the resource file
+ */
+ protected final List<AbstractResourceNode> rootNodes;
+
+ /**
+ * Default constructor
+ */
+ public AbstractResourceFileParser()
+ {
+ rootNodes = new LinkedList<AbstractResourceNode>();
+ }
+
+ /**
+ * Parses an IDocument object containing a resource file content
+ *
+ * @param document the IDocument object
+ * @param sourceFileName The resource file that is being parsed
+ *
+ * @throws SAXException When a parsing error occurs
+ * @throws IOException When a reading error occurs
+ */
+ public void parseDocument(IDocument document, String sourceFileName) throws AndroidException
+ {
+ Element element;
+ DOMParser domParser = new DOMParser();
+
+ rootNodes.clear();
+
+ StringReader stringReader = null;
+ try
+ {
+ stringReader = new StringReader(document.get());
+ domParser.parse(new InputSource(stringReader));
+ }
+ catch (SAXException e)
+ {
+ String errMsg =
+ NLS.bind(CodeUtilsNLS.EXC_AbstractResourceFileParser_ErrorParsingTheXMLFile,
+ sourceFileName, e.getLocalizedMessage());
+ StudioLogger.error(AbstractResourceFileParser.class, errMsg, e);
+ throw new AndroidException(errMsg);
+ }
+ catch (IOException e)
+ {
+ String errMsg =
+ NLS.bind(CodeUtilsNLS.EXC_AbstractResourceFileParser_ErrorReadingTheXMLContent,
+ sourceFileName, e.getLocalizedMessage());
+ StudioLogger.error(AbstractResourceFileParser.class, errMsg, e);
+ throw new AndroidException(errMsg);
+ }
+ finally
+ {
+ if (stringReader != null)
+ {
+ stringReader.close();
+ }
+ }
+
+ element = domParser.getDocument().getDocumentElement();
+ parseNode(element, null);
+ }
+
+ /**
+ * Parses a XML Node
+ *
+ * @param element The XML Node
+ * @param rootNode The XML Node parent (An AbstractResourceNode that has been parsed)
+ */
+ private void parseNode(Node node, AbstractResourceNode rootNode)
+ {
+ if (node instanceof Element)
+ {
+ Element element = (Element) node;
+ AbstractResourceNode arNode;
+ Node xmlNode;
+ NodeList xmlChildNodes;
+ NamedNodeMap attributes = element.getAttributes();
+ NodeType nodeType = identifyNode(element);
+
+ switch (nodeType)
+ {
+ case Resources:
+ arNode = parseResourcesNode();
+ break;
+ case String:
+ arNode = parseStringNode(attributes);
+ break;
+ case Color:
+ arNode = parseColorNode(attributes);
+ break;
+ case Dimen:
+ arNode = parseDimenNode(attributes);
+ break;
+ case Drawable:
+ arNode = parseDrawableNode(attributes);
+ break;
+ default:
+ arNode = parseUnknownNode(node);
+ }
+
+ // Adds the child nodes
+ xmlChildNodes = element.getChildNodes();
+
+ for (int i = 0; i < xmlChildNodes.getLength(); i++)
+ {
+ xmlNode = xmlChildNodes.item(i);
+ parseNode(xmlNode, arNode);
+ }
+
+ if (rootNode == null)
+ {
+ rootNodes.add(arNode);
+ }
+ else
+ {
+ rootNode.addChildNode(arNode);
+ }
+ }
+ else if ((node instanceof Text) && (rootNode != null))
+ {
+ if ((node.getNodeValue() != null) && (node.getNodeValue().trim().length() > 0))
+ {
+ if (rootNode instanceof AbstractSimpleNameResourceNode)
+ {
+ AbstractSimpleNameResourceNode asnrNode =
+ (AbstractSimpleNameResourceNode) rootNode;
+ if (asnrNode.getNodeValue() == null)
+ {
+ asnrNode.setNodeValue(node.getNodeValue());
+ }
+ }
+ else
+ {
+ UnknownNode unknownNode = (UnknownNode) rootNode;
+ if (unknownNode.getNodeValue() == null)
+ {
+ unknownNode.setNodeValue(node.getNodeValue());
+ }
+ }
+ }
+ }
+ }
